Types Of Gas Lines Used In Cooktop Installations
Residents and business owners in Tarpon Springs, Florida rely on various gas lines for safe cooktop installations. The most common types include flexible stainless steel tubing, black iron pipe, and corrugated stainless steel tubing (CSST). Choosing the correct gas line is vital for safety, efficiency, and compliance with local codes. Flexible Stainless Steel Tubing
In Tarpon Springs, flexible stainless steel tubing is favored for its ability to navigate tight spaces easily. This tubing offers corrosion resistance and a reliable connection to gas cooktops. Black Iron Pipe
Black iron pipe is often chosen in Tarpon Springs for its robustness and suitability for high-pressure gas lines. It is commonly used for the primary gas supply feeding cooktops in both residential and commercial settings. Professionals in Tarpon Springs handle the precise threading and sealing necessary for safe operation.
Corrugated Stainless Steel Tubing (CSST)
CSST provides a flexible, lightweight option for gas lines in Tarpon Springs, simplifying installations in complicated layouts. Proper bonding and grounding, performed by trained local installers, protect against electrical hazards.
